Output 9d985643c27438581ed08228c23b187dd2dc077db501303d0a58886d911ba5d8:7

value
14558866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53fa58e57cad54938132a2e304b083f27fab2f9e OP_EQUAL
address
39M3uu225qMTCYZvorcHd49pdimvhjBQ7e
transaction
9d985643c27438581ed08228c23b187dd2dc077db501303d0a58886d911ba5d8
spent
true